When sand and salt is added to water the salt dissloves and the sand sinks to the bottom what process could you use to recover both the sand and the salt?

1. Filtering the liquid sand remain on the filter. 2. The solution containing salt pass the filter; after the evaporation of water crystallized NaCl is obtained.


What kind of chemical relation is wet sand?

In general, water and sand do not have a chemical relationship. Something might happen if the sand grains are partially composed of a mineral that is water soluble. In that case, water will dissolve water soluble material in sand. But that is a physicalactivity and not a chemical one. Water and sand do not react chemically.

What is the fineness modulus of sand?

The Fineness Modulus (FM) is an index number which is roughly proportional to the average size of the particles in an aggregate sample. It is obtained by adding the cumulative percentages coarser than each of the standard sieves used for segregating sand and dividing the cumulative percentage by 100.

Do you get salt from sand?

No, salt is obtained by evaporating seawater or by mining rocks formed by the evaporation of seawater.
